Hi mate,

I'm currently building a Cat 2 rally car.....
I too used to rally in the eighties... Its all changed now lol.
You'll certainly need a "tin top" ;)
Best advice is download the current "MSA Blue Book" and have a good old read of the rally car regs.
Join a local motor club and get friendly with a scrutineer they will be invaluable with advice and can check yr car during it's build advising you along the way, and will finally photo it and inspect it and give you a CCLB (competition car log book).
